Hopefully you’re used to seeing “Brionac, Dragon of the Ice Barrier” by now. Since it dwells in the Extra Deck almost everyone will play a copy, and since it’s Level 6 it’s really easy to Summon. Brionac’s effect lets you discard cards from your hand to return cards on the field to their owner’s hand. You can discard as many cards as you’d like and may use the effect as many times as you’d like during your turn. That’s a big part of what makes this card so good. In a Zombie Deck, you can use “Goblin Zombie” and “Plaguespreader Zombie” to make “Brionac, Dragon of the Ice Barrier.” With “Goblin Zombie’s” effect you can search out “Mezuki,” who can then be discarded to Brionac’s effect. Mezuki can then be used to bring back “Goblin Zombie.” You can take this even further, bringing back “Plaguespreader Zombie” with its own effect and making another Level 6 Synchro Monster.
